- 背景
- Chemokine (C-X-C motif) ligand 1 (CXCL1) is a small molecule of cytokines belonging to the CXC chemokine family.
- Also known as growth-regulated oncogene alpha (Growth-regulated oncogene alpha, GROα).
- It's also known as keratinocytes-derived chemokine (KC) in mice or cytokine-induced neutrophil chemoattractant type-1 (CINC-1) in rats.
- In humans, this protein is encoded by the gene Cxcl1 and is located on human chromosome 4 among genes for other CXC chemokines.
- The chemokine CXCL1 is expressed by macrophages, neutrophils and epithelial cells.
- The chemokine CXCL1 has a chemotactic effect on neutrophils.
- CXCL1 binds to the chemokine receptor CXCR2 and plays a role in cell chemotaxis.
- Human CXCL1 is clustered on chromosome 4 adjacent to many CXC chemokine genes.
- Major roles of CXCL1 include neovascularization, inflammation, wound healing, and tumorigenesis
- 特徴
- This protein carries a human IgG1 Fc tag at the C-terminus.
- The protein has a calculated MW of 34.3 kDa.
- The protein migrates as 37-43 kDa under reducing (R) condition (SDS-PAGE) due to glycosylation.
